Abstract
The invention discloses a kind of operation of air conditioner control method, methods described includes the control process of the intelligent control mode for executing following:Real-time indoor temperature is made comparisons with indoor temperature desired value, judges whether the real-time indoor temperature meets the comfortable condition of indoor temperature;If the real-time indoor temperature is unsatisfactory for the comfortable condition of the indoor temperature, control indoor fan is run with setting speed;If the real-time indoor temperature meets the comfortable condition of the indoor temperature, obtain the real-time room temperature temperature difference between the real-time indoor temperature and the indoor temperature desired value, PID arithmetic is carried out based on the real-time room temperature temperature difference, determines real-time rotating speed, control indoor fan is run with the real-time rotating speed.The application present invention, can solve the problems, such as that existing air conditioner wind speed adjusts inaccurate, comfortable sexual experience poor.

Specific embodiment
In order that the objects, technical solutions and advantages of the present invention become more apparent, below with reference to drawings and Examples,
The present invention is described in further detail.
Fig. 1 is referred to, the flow chart that the figure show the one embodiment based on operation of air conditioner control method of the present invention.
As schematically shown in Figure 1, the embodiment realize operation of air conditioner control method include execute following step constitute intelligence
The control process of control model:
Step 11:Real-time indoor temperature is made comparisons with indoor temperature desired value, judges whether real-time indoor temperature meets interior
The condition of temperature pleasant.
During indoor temperature refers to operation of air conditioner in real time, using temperature sensor according to acquired in setting sample frequency
The indoor environment temperature of reflection indoor air temperature.For example, can be passed by being arranged on the temperature of indoor apparatus of air conditioner air inlet
Sensor gets the temperature value to detect the temperature and by the controller on air-conditioning computer plate.Indoor temperature desired value is referred to
An indoor environment temperature to be reached is expected by the regulation of air-conditioning, and the value can be the setting value of user, e.g.
The desired temperature that user is input into by remote control or Air-Conditioning Control Panel;The value can also be one of air-conditioning system and preset
Value, for example, a comfort temperature value pre-setting when being operation of air conditioner intelligent control mode and can be got by computer board.
In operation of air conditioner, the real-time indoor temperature for obtaining is made comparisons with indoor temperature desired value, to judge real-time room
Whether interior temperature meets the comfortable condition of indoor temperature.Wherein, the comfortable condition of indoor temperature is also the bar for pre-setting
Part, and, it is the condition judged by the comparison by real-time indoor temperature and indoor temperature desired value.
Used as preferred embodiment, the comfortable condition of indoor temperature is that real-time indoor temperature is equal to indoor temperature target
Value, or, it is to be less than to set difference for real-time indoor temperature with the difference of indoor temperature desired value.That is, indoor temperature is comfortable
Condition be that indoor temperature has reached indoor temperature desired value, or the difference of indoor temperature and indoor temperature desired value is relatively
Little.If that is, indoor temperature meets the comfortable condition of indoor temperature in real time, showing that now indoor temperature is more relaxed
Suitable.
Step 12:Based on the comparison of step 11, judge whether real-time indoor temperature meets the comfortable condition of indoor temperature.
If being unsatisfactory for condition, execution step 13;If meeting, execution step 14.
Step 13:Control indoor fan is run with setting speed.
The rotating speed for presetting during setting speed and storing, is so that indoor temperature can be rapidly achieved indoor temperature comfortable
Condition rotating speed, that is, being the rotating speed for realizing fast-refrigerating or heating effect.
Specifically, setting speed includes setting speed corresponding to operation of air conditioner refrigeration mode and operation of air conditioner is heated
Setting speed corresponding to pattern.
Wherein, for cooling operation mode, the maximum speed that setting speed is allowed for indoor fan.So, in air-conditioning system
Under cold operation pattern, if in real time indoor temperature is unsatisfactory for the comfortable condition of indoor temperature, control indoor fan to allow
Maximum speed as setting speed run, to accelerate spatial flow speed in room so that indoor temperature rapid decrease and reach
The comfortable condition of indoor temperature, realizes fast-refrigerating effect.
For heating operation mode, setting speed includes the maximum speed of indoor fan permission and minimum speed, according to reality
When indoor temperature height determine setting speed for maximum speed or minimum speed.Specifically, mould is run in air-conditioning heating
Under formula, the detailed process for controlling indoor fan to run with setting speed is as follows:
Under air-conditioning heating operational mode, if indoor temperature is unsatisfactory for the comfortable condition of indoor temperature in real time, judge indoor in real time
Whether temperature is more than design temperature.Wherein, design temperature is a temperature set in advance, and the room being less than under heating mode
One temperature of interior temperature target.
If indoor temperature is more than design temperature in real time, the maximum speed for controlling indoor fan to allow is transported as setting speed
OK, to accelerate spatial flow speed in room so that indoor temperature rapid increase and reach the comfortable condition of indoor temperature, realize
Quick heating effect.
And if indoor temperature is not more than design temperature in real time, bringing not for the flow at high speed of the air for avoiding temperature not high
Comfortable, the minimum speed for controlling indoor fan to allow is run as setting speed.
Also, as preferred embodiment, it is to improve the discomfort for quickly heating speed, reducing human body further
Receive, at least when real-time indoor temperature is not more than design temperature, the electric heater unit of air-conditioning is opened, produced using electric heater unit
Heat aiding in a liter high air temperature.More than design temperature but the comfortable bar of indoor temperature is unsatisfactory in real-time indoor temperature
During part, electric heater unit can select to cut out, it is also possible to select to open.Run with setting speed in control indoor fan
During, still constantly obtain real-time indoor temperature and judge whether indoor temperature meets the comfortable condition of indoor temperature.
If be unsatisfactory for, control indoor fan continues to run according to setting speed;And if meeting, the control process of execution step 14.
Step 14:The real-time room temperature temperature difference between real-time indoor temperature and indoor temperature desired value is obtained, based on real-time room
The temperature difference carries out PID arithmetic, determines real-time rotating speed, and control indoor fan is run with real-time rotating speed.
If it is determined that indoor temperature meets the comfortable condition of indoor temperature in real time, show that indoor temperature has reached more
Comfortable value.Hereafter, PID control will be carried out to the rotating speed of indoor fan according to the room temperature temperature difference.Specifically, obtain indoor in real time
The real-time room temperature temperature difference between temperature and indoor temperature desired value, carries out PID arithmetic based on the real-time room temperature temperature difference, determines in real time and turns
Speed, control indoor fan are run with real-time rotating speed.
As preferred embodiment, incremental timestamp will be carried out to the rotating speed of indoor fan according to the room temperature temperature difference.
Specifically, the real-time room temperature temperature difference between real-time indoor temperature and indoor temperature desired value is obtained, based on the real-time room temperature temperature difference
Increment type PID computing is carried out, determines real-time rotating speed, control indoor fan is run with real-time rotating speed.Increment type is executed according to deviation
The concrete formula of PID arithmetic control and realize process and may be referred to prior art.
Certainly, during being run according to the real-time rotating speed control indoor fan that the interior temperature difference determines in real time, still constantly
Ground obtains real-time indoor temperature and judges whether indoor temperature meets the comfortable condition of indoor temperature.If it is satisfied, continuing step
Rapid 14 control process;And once being unsatisfactory for the comfortable condition of indoor temperature, then execution step 13, controls indoor fan to set
Rotating speed runs.
Operation of air conditioner control is carried out using the method for above-described embodiment, temperature is unsatisfactory for the comfortable bar of indoor temperature indoors
During part, the rotating speed for controlling indoor fan to set runs so that room temperature can be rapidly achieved the comfortable condition of indoor temperature,
Realize fast-refrigerating or the effect for heating.And when temperature meets the comfortable condition of indoor temperature indoors, based on real-time Indoor Temperature
The real-time room temperature temperature difference between degree and indoor temperature desired value carries out PID arithmetic to determine real-time rotating speed, control indoor fan with
Rotating speed operation in real time, it is achieved that the precise control to the stepless adjustable of wind speed.It is additionally, since to indoor fan according to room temperature temperature
Difference carries out the control of continuous rotating speed, can reduce the discomfort that wind speed is not suitable for and human body is caused so that the control of air-conditioning
More accurately, rationally, human body comfort is higher.
Used as preferably a kind of embodiment, air-conditioning is after startup intelligent control mode instruction is received, then executes as above
State the control process of the intelligent control mode of embodiment.And, intelligent control mode instruction can pass through remote control, control panel
Or APP triggering.
And, intelligent control mode instruction includes multiple instructions for different user colony, and user can be according to need
Send one of instruction.Also, prestore in air-conditioning and the one-to-one indoor temperature desired value of each user group.
When the control process of intelligent control mode is executed, first the user group institute is got according to the targeted user group of instruction
Corresponding indoor temperature desired value, as the indoor temperature desired value that makes comparisons with real-time indoor temperature, naturally also room
The desired value of interior temperature adjusting.
For example, by taking cooling operation mode as an example, intelligent control mode instruction includes old man/children's instruction, green grass or young crops and strengthens
Instruct in year, cold people's GC group command and happiness thermal man's GC group command is liked, the user group that old man/children's instruction is directed to is old man and children, its
Corresponding indoor temperature desired value is 28 DEG C;The targeted user group of between twenty and fifty instruction is person between twenty and fifty, the room corresponding to which
Interior temperature target is 27 DEG C;The targeted user group of cold people's GC group command is liked for cryophilic crowd, the interior corresponding to which
Temperature target is 26 DEG C;The targeted user group of happiness thermal man's GC group command is the crowd for liking heat, the Indoor Temperature corresponding to which
Degree desired value is 28 DEG C.If intelligent control mode instruction is between twenty and fifty instruction, first by corresponding between twenty and fifty instruction 27
DEG C as indoor temperature desired value;Then, the intelligence of indoor temperature and indoor set wind speed is carried out based on the indoor temperature desired value
Control.
As another preferred embodiment, during Based Intelligent Control, if it is decided that indoor temperature is discontented with real time
The comfortable condition of sufficient indoor temperature, in addition to controlling indoor set with setting speed operation, still with indoor temperature as adjusting target,
Compressor operating frequency is determined based on real-time indoor temperature and indoor temperature desired value, controls compressor operating, so that room
Interior temperature reaches comfort temperature as early as possible.
As preferred embodiment, compressor operating frequency is determined based on real-time indoor temperature and indoor temperature desired value
Rate, controls compressor operating, specifically includes:
The real-time room temperature temperature difference between real-time indoor temperature and indoor temperature desired value is obtained, is increased based on the real-time room temperature temperature difference
Amount formula PID arithmetic, determines Real Time Compression machine running frequency, controls compressor operating according to Real Time Compression machine running frequency.It is based on
Deviation is carried out the specific algorithm of increment type PID computing and can be realized using prior art, and here is not elaborated.
